Raytheon Strengthens Australian Naval Defense with SeaRAM Integration

May 11 2026

On May 11, 2026, RTX’s Raytheon has been selected to support Australia’s Sea3000 General Purpose Frigate program by providing SeaRAM ship self-defense systems for the Royal Australian Navy’s new MOGAMI-class frigates.

Awarded by Mitsubishi Heavy Industries, the contract marks Australia’s first procurement of the SeaRAM system and supports the transition from the ANZAC-class fleet. Deliveries are expected in 2028.

By integrating the Phalanx Close-In Weapon System with the Rolling Airframe Missile, SeaRAM delivers autonomous terminal defense against cruise missiles and sophisticated airborne threats.
